WebBank M offers you a home mortgage loan of 125% of the FMV of the home less any outstanding mortgages or other liens. To consolidate some of your other debts, you take out a $42,500 home mortgage loan [ (125% × $110,000) - $95,000] with Bank M. Your home equity debt is limited to $15,000. It's called an 80/20 loan because the first part is a mortgage that covers 80% of the home … cwricwlwmWeb25 feb. 2024 · The mortgage interest deduction is a tax deduction for mortgage interest paid on the first $1 million of mortgage debt. Homeowners who bought houses after Dec. 15, 2024, can deduct interest on the first $750,000 of the mortgage. Claiming the mortgage interest deduction requires itemizing on your tax return. cwria
